The Chamber of Commerce & Industry France-Mozambique (Camara de Comercio e Industria França-Moçambique) (CCIFM) was created in Maputo in 2015 at the initiative of French companies established in the country. Our vision is to promote bilateral trade and strengthen business, commercial & industrial exchanges between France and Mozambique. The CCIFM facilitates access of French companies to the Mozambican market (from export to office set-up and search of local partners) and it supports Mozambican organizations in their business expansion plans in France.

We have, over the years, developed a powerful network of institutional and corporate partners in both Mozambique & France, to best defend the interests of our current +140 member companies. Our member base encompasses Blue-Chips, Mid-Caps, SMEs, and Entrepreneurs, from a wide variety of economic sectors: Energy, Transport & Logistics, Professional Services (financial, legal, tax…), Healthcare, Automotive, Agribusiness, IT and much more. We welcome predominantly French & Mozambican companies and have quite a significant number of companies from other nationalities too.

The CCIFM strives from the unique network of other French Chambers of Commerce across the world, especially those located in Sub-Saharan and Eastern Africa. We are part of the CCI France-International network, headquartered in Paris and made up of not less than 119 French Chambers of Commerce & Industry in 94 countries.

Our missions can simply be summarized as follows: we are here to build a network, connect businesses amongst each other, to ultimately generate business opportunities.
